"Inhabited Island" to shake strategy gamers in less than a year: first screens released!
In less than a year the world of Strugatsky brothers' bestseller "Inhabitated Island" will shake the
gaming community in explosive turn-based strategy by Wargaming.net and Akella.
Khonties, Barbarians and the Island Empire, being all unyielding enemies, will get involved in
fierce warfare set to destroy the entire race of the Land of Fathers. Each race will possess and
develop easily distinguishable technologies. Therefore, heavy armored, transport, and
aviation units, each of absolutely different construction will be present on the battlefield. The battles
will take place among 3D vivid extraterrestrial landscapes, with day and night change and dynamic
weather conditions that will affect the gameplay. A haze of exhausted gases poise over steel battle machines;
the ground gets blasted by tracks of tanks and other heavy vehicles; artillery fire scratches,
burns and breaches heavily armored units.
The game will offer tremendous strategic
depth featuring fog of war, troop-carrying vehicles, return fire, laying mines, camouflage and tons
of other strategic and tactical techniques. To enjoy the delight of "Inhabited Island" wargame theatre

Game features include:
Immersive storyline based on "Inhabited Island " (aka "Prisoners of Power") by the Strugatsky brothers
4 totally unique races: Land of the Fathers, Khonties, Barbarians and Island Empire
Realistic battle system (camouflage, fog of war, return fire, mine laying, fortifications, land and air troop carriers)
Advanced technology tree and unit upgrade system
Realistic full 3D environment with day/night change and weather effects
Cinematic Camera mode showing the most dramatic moments
The game will be published in Russia by Akella. Visit Akella's booth at E3 this year for more materials and the Demo

About Akella (http://www.akella.com)
Headquartered in Moscow, Akella is one of the leading companies on Russian gaming market. Founded in 1995, Akella
specializes in developing, publishing and distibuting of computer games and multimedia products, having more
than 20 projects developed and more than 200 published.Much attention is paid to fast-growing console
games market. Akella is the first Russian company that started deloping projects for PlayStation 2 and Xbox.
About Wargaming.net:
Wargaming.net, Inc. is a game development company based in New Orleans, Louisiana. Since 1998,
Wargaming.net has specialized in creating strategy games. Wargaming.net's mission is to bring the feel
of innovation to the strategy genre.
